Portrait medallions ca. 1782 French Depicting the French King Louis XVI (1754-1793) and his wife Queen Marie Antoinette (1755-1793), these portraits are adaptations of medals by Benjamin Duvivier (1730-1819) of 1781 and may have derived from an engraving after the artist. The technical and stylistic similarities between goldsmiths’ work and that in gilt bronze are seldom as apparent as in this Portrait medallions 190072 French, Portrait medallions, ca. 1782, Gilt bronze, Overall (confirmed): 4 1/4 ? 7 1/4 in. ( ? cm). The Metropolitan Museum of Art, New York. Gift of J. Pierpont Morgan, 1906 ()
